What Your Job Will Be Like:

We are se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Administrative Support professional to join our team. This role plays a critical part in managing classified mail channels and providing essential administrative support to the Classified Matter Protection & Control (CMPC) team.

On any given day, you may be called on to:

  • Serve as the primary point of contact and subject matter expert for classified mail channels across all Sandia sites.
  • Coordinate with SNL, external security POCs, and federal agencies (DOE, NNSA, OST).
  • Manage the full lifecycle of the Classified Mail Channel (CMC) program, including requests, channel setup, maintenance, and SOP improvements.
  • Maintain and update critical security databases ensuring data integrity.
  • Review, validate, and submit required federal forms; ensure compliance with security policies.
  • Provide timely troubleshooting and support for classified mail communications internally and with external partners.
  • Collect and analyze operational metrics; prepare performance and compliance reports for leadership.
  • Support CMPC team with supply requests, audit activities, and training administration, including material prep and tracking completions in the corporate training system.

About Our Team:

The Classified Matter Protection & Control (CMPC), Operations Security (OPSEC) and Insider Threat teams are the primary points of contact to implement DOE O 471.6, Information Security, NNSA Supplemental Directive 417.6, Operations Security Program and DOE O 470.5, Insider Threat Program. These teams collaborate with both federal and SNL points of contact to effectively establish policy, deploy training/briefings, and lead/support assurance related activities to ensure successful implementation of their respected program requirements.

Security Clearance:

Position requires a Department of Energy (DOE) Q security clearance to start, or equivalent active security clearance with another U.S. government agency (e.g., DOD). Sandia is required by DOE directive to conduct a pre-employment drug test and background review that includes checks of personal references, credit, law enforcement records, and employment/education verifications. Applicants for employment need to be able to maintain a DOE Q-level security clearance, which requires U.S. citizenship. If you hold more than one citizenship (i.e., of the U.S. and another country), your ability to obtain a security clearance may be impacted.

Applicants offered employment with Sandia are subject to a federal background investigation to meet the requirements for access to classified information or matter if the duties of the position require a DOE security clearance. Substance abuse or illegal drug use, falsification of information, criminal activity, serious misconduct or other indicators of untrustworthiness can cause a clearance to be denied or terminated by DOE, resulting in the inability to perform the duties assigned and subsequent termination of employment.

NNSA Requirements for MedPEDs:

If you have a Medical Portable Electronic Device (MedPED), such as a pacemaker, defibrillator, drug-releasing pump, hearing aids, or diagnostic equipment and other equipment for measuring, monitoring, and recording body functions such as heartbeat and brain waves, if employed by Sandia National Laboratories you may be required to comply with NNSA security requirements for MedPEDs.

If you have a MedPED and you are selected for an on-site interview at Sandia National Laboratories, there may be additional steps necessary to ensure compliance with NNSA security requirements prior to the interview date.
